Early Career and College Stats

Matthew Stafford's journey began at the University of Georgia, where he quickly established himself as a top college quarterback. His impressive performance during his college years laid the foundation for a successful NFL career. Here's a look at his key college stats:

  • Passing Yards: 7,731 yards
  • Touchdowns: 51
  • Completion Percentage: 57.8%
  • Rushing Yards: 187 yards

Impact on the Detroit Lions

Stafford was drafted by the Detroit Lions in 2009, and his arrival marked a new era for the team. He quickly became the face of the franchise, showcasing his arm talent and competitive spirit. His time with the Lions was characterized by record-breaking performances and the development of a strong offensive core. Here's how he performed in the team:

  • Passing Yards: 45,109 yards
  • Touchdowns: 282
  • Completion Percentage: 62.6%
  • Games Played: 165

Stafford's tenure with the Lions was a mixed bag, with individual success often overshadowed by team struggles. However, his individual achievements and resilience endeared him to the Lions faithful.

Playoff and Super Bowl Performance

Stafford's playoff performances and, especially, his Super Bowl appearance, are highlights of his career. His ability to elevate his game in crucial moments demonstrates his ability to perform at the highest levels.

  • Super Bowl LVI: Stafford led the Los Angeles Rams to victory, earning a Super Bowl ring, throwing for 283 yards and 3 touchdowns. It was a testament to his resilience and talent. It was his first appearance in the Super Bowl.
  • Playoff Statistics: In 9 playoff games, Stafford has thrown for 2,419 yards and 17 touchdowns. His playoff stats highlight his ability to perform under pressure and make critical plays when the stakes are high.

Impact on the Los Angeles Rams

Joining the Los Angeles Rams in 2021 marked a new chapter in Stafford's career. He brought veteran leadership and a winning mentality to the team, culminating in a Super Bowl victory. Stafford's trade to the Rams paid dividends immediately as they won the Super Bowl in his first season. He added another dimension to the Rams' offense. With him on the team, they could contend with the best teams in the league.

  • Passing Yards: 8,995 yards
  • Touchdowns: 56
  • Completion Percentage: 62.0%
